Job description

Must be a US Citizen or Green Card holder and local to the Metro DC Area.

Responsibilities:

  • Create data mapping documents that outline the relationships between source and target data fields.
  • Design and implement ETL processes to load data into the Data Warehouse, ensuring efficient performance and data integrity.
  • Utilize ETL tools for data integration.
  • Validate data accuracy and completeness post-migration to ensure that all data has been successfully transferred.
  • Work closely with business analysts, data architects, and stakeholders to understand data requirements and ensure alignment with business objectives.
  • Analyze requirements for BI reports and dashboards and analyze data sources for mapping to BI requirements.
  • Work closely with customers to determine the best approach for the user community and use BI tools to develop reports, dashboards, and widgets; create and execute test plans; coordinate life cycle activities from development to production.
  • Create and maintain data models to support requirements and determine the best approach for data delivery depending on data sources and requirements.
  • Develop spreadsheets and databases as needed to support interim strategies for data and to analyze and gather the requirements of BI data from users/customers.
  • Create ETL/ELT for Peoplesoft EPM Datawarehouse.
  • Maintain the ERP data warehouse and Ascential/Datastage environments.
  • Design and develop data models and data mart tables and develop ETL processes and data pipelines using Data Stage ETL tool.
  • Support and maintain Production ETL processes and jobs of Data Stage.
  • Support and fulfill adhoc data requests from customers and management using SQL queries and Excel sheets; perform data validation, accuracy, and completeness during delivery of the data.
  • Support other BI team members during development of reports and dashboards for their data needs.
  • Document product specifications, create user guides for operations, and support cyber security reviews and implement remediations as required.
